+       /**
+        * Insert or reparent an element. Create p-wrappers or split the tag stack
+        * as necessary.
+        *
+        * Consider the following insertion locations. The parent may be:
+        *
+        *   - A: A body or blockquote (!!needsPWrapping)
+        *   - B: A p-wrapper (!!isPWrapper)
+        *   - C: A descendant of a p-wrapper (!!ancestorPNode)
+        *     - CS: With splittable formatting elements in the stack region up to
+        *       the p-wrapper
+        *     - CU: With one or more unsplittable elements in the stack region up
+        *       to the p-wrapper
+        *   - D: Not a descendant of a p-wrapper (!ancestorNode)
+        *     - DS: With splittable formatting elements in the stack region up to
+        *       the body or blockquote
+        *     - DU: With one or more unsplittable elements in the stack region up
+        *       to the body or blockquote
+        *
+        * And consider that we may insert two types of element:
+        *   - b: block
+        *   - i: inline
+        *
+        * We handle the insertion as follows:
+        *
+        *   - A/i: Create a p-wrapper, insert under it
+        *   - A/b: Insert as normal
+        *   - B/i: Insert as normal
+        *   - B/b: Close the p-wrapper, insert under the body/blockquote (wrap
+        *     base) instead)
+        *   - C/i: Insert as normal
+        *   - CS/b: Split the tag stack, insert the block under cloned formatting
+        *     elements which have the wrap base (the parent of the p-wrap) as
+        *     their ultimate parent.
+        *   - CU/b: Disable the p-wrap, by reparenting the currently open child
+        *     of the p-wrap under the p-wrap's parent. Then insert the block as
+        *     normal.
+        *   - D/b: Insert as normal
+        *   - DS/i: Split the tag stack, creating a new p-wrapper as the ultimate
+        *     parent of the formatting elements thus cloned. The parent of the
+        *     p-wrapper is the body or blockquote.
+        *   - DU/i: Insert as normal
+        *
+        * FIXME: fostering ($preposition == BEFORE) is mostly done by inserting as
+        * normal, the full algorithm is not followed.
+        *
+        * @param int $preposition
+        * @param Element|SerializerNode|null $refElement
+        * @param Element $element
+        * @param bool $void
+        * @param int $sourceStart
+        * @param int $sourceLength
+        */
